Man arrested during home invasion in Jefferson County

A man was arrested early Thursday after breaking into a home in Jefferson County, according to the sheriff’s office.

Deputies were sent to a home in the 5500 block of South Eldridge St. in Morrison about 3:10 a.m. after a report of a home invasion. The caller told dispatchers that someone broke down the front door and was wandering inside the home, according to the Jefferson County Sheriff’s Office. 

Two people who were home armed themselves with handguns and hid in the basement before crawling out of the home through an egress window.

A K9 officer and his K9 partner, Geist, responded to the home and commanded the intruder to “show themselves to deputies,” according to the release. He failed to comply with the demands and was found hiding behind a couch by Geist. 

Aris Ashford, 39, suffered bite wounds from the dog and was transported to St. Anthony Hospital for his injuries. He was later taken into police custody and booked into the Jefferson County Detention Facility.

Ashford is being held on suspicion of committing second-degree burglary, criminal mischief and theft, according to the sheriff’s office.
